Bus Plunges into River in Bangladesh, 40 Passengers Onboard in Tragic Accident
A devastating bus accident occurred in Bangladesh when a vehicle carrying approximately 40 passengers plunged into a river, leading to a tragic incident that has shocked the local community. The bus was traveling on a route when it veered off the road and fell into the water, resulting in immediate rescue efforts by emergency services.
Details of the Incident
The accident took place in Bangladesh, with the bus plunging into the river while fully loaded with passengers. Initial reports indicate that the bus was en route to its destination when the driver lost control, causing the vehicle to crash into the river. Authorities have confirmed that rescue teams are actively working at the scene to retrieve passengers and assess the situation.
Rescue Operations Underway
Rescue operations are currently in full swing, with local police, fire services, and volunteers collaborating to save lives and recover the bus. The challenging conditions of the river have complicated efforts, but teams are using boats and diving equipment to search for survivors and victims. Medical personnel are on standby to provide immediate assistance to those rescued.
